Hi everyone, like last year I'm currently working to release some ISO's including PLF packages
The first working DVD I tested yesterday. It is based on 2007.0 Release (Mandriva + PLF), contains the current updates and the needed Contrib packages. I will also try to make 4 CD ISO's for people who don't want download the big DVD ISO. At the moment you can select the following PLF packages during Install, the rest after Installation with urpmi: xsnow, umpnbump, spacehulk, qfcc, quakeforge-clients-fbdev, quakeforge-clients-glx, quakeforge-clients-sdl, quakeforge-clients-sdlgl, quakeforge-clients-x11, quakeforge-common, quakeforge-maptools, quakeforge-plugins, quakeforge-servers, quakeforge-utils, xmule, nicotine, amule,mldonkey, mldonkey-chat, mldonkey-ed2k_submit, mldonkey-guimldonkey-init,lopster, napshare, gtk-gnutella, qtella, mythtv, mythtv-frontend, mythtv-backend, mythtv-setup, mythvideo, googleearth, kmldonkey, transcode, Video-DVDRip, vobcopy, dvdshrink, win32-codecs, cinelerra, pine, unarj, unace, unrar, unarj Are there any wishes or important packages missing (perhaps there is a list with favorite packages)?
